„scripts/start-server.sh“ ändern

This commit is contained in:
2020-01-19 18:58:59 +01:00
parent 6b48f85d95
commit e3814a5bdb

View File

@@ -51,11 +51,12 @@ if [ ! -d ${SERVER_DIR}/data ]; then
mkdir ${SERVER_DIR}/data mkdir ${SERVER_DIR}/data
cd ${SERVER_DIR}/data cd ${SERVER_DIR}/data
echo "---Downloading ExileMod Server---" echo "---Downloading ExileMod Server---"
wget -q --show-progress ${EXILEMOD_SERVER_URL} if wget -q -nc --show-progress --progress=bar:force:noscroll ${EXILEMOD_SERVER_URL} ; then
if [ ! -f ${SERVER_DIR}/data/${EXILEMOD_SERVER_URL##*/} ]; then echo "---Sucessfully downloaded ExileMod Server---"
echo "---Something went wrong, could not find download---" else
echo "---Can't download ExileMod Server, putting server into sleep mode---"
sleep infinity sleep infinity
fi fi
unzip ${EXILEMOD_SERVER_URL##*/} unzip ${EXILEMOD_SERVER_URL##*/}
cp -R ${SERVER_DIR}/data/Arma\ 3\ Server/* ${SERVER_DIR} cp -R ${SERVER_DIR}/data/Arma\ 3\ Server/* ${SERVER_DIR}
rm -R ${SERVER_DIR}/data/Arma\ 3\ Server/ rm -R ${SERVER_DIR}/data/Arma\ 3\ Server/
@@ -67,11 +68,13 @@ if [ ! -d ${SERVER_DIR}/data ]; then
fi fi
echo "---ExileMod Server successfully installed---" echo "---ExileMod Server successfully installed---"
echo "---Downloading ExileMod (this can take some time)---" echo "---Downloading ExileMod (this can take some time)---"
wget -q --show-progress ${EXILEMOD_URL} cd ${SERVER_DIR}/data
if [ ! -f ${SERVER_DIR}/data/${EXILEMOD_URL##*/} ]; then if wget -q -nc --show-progress --progress=bar:force:noscroll ${EXILEMOD_URL} ; then
echo "---Something went wrong, could not find download---" echo "---Sucessfully downloaded ExileMod---"
sleep infinity else
fi echo "---Can't download ExileMod, putting server into sleep mode---"
sleep infinity
fi
unzip ${EXILEMOD_URL##*/} unzip ${EXILEMOD_URL##*/}
mv ${SERVER_DIR}/data/@Exile ${SERVER_DIR} mv ${SERVER_DIR}/data/@Exile ${SERVER_DIR}
rm ${SERVER_DIR}/data/${EXILEMOD_URL##*/} rm ${SERVER_DIR}/data/${EXILEMOD_URL##*/}